The Position:

The Director of Clinical Services, Pharmacy, will support the overall company-wide management of Pharmacy and Clinical Service. The Director of Clinical Services will direct high-quality pharmacy and clinical services in accordance with established policies, procedures and laws regulating pharmacy practice. Responsibilities Include:

  • Supports company-wide pharmacy and clinical operation functions to ensure safe and cost-effective operations.
  • Sets high standards of performance for area personnel and ensures adherence to all company philosophies, procedures, and regulations.
  • Leads oversight of Clinical Services support to ensure clinical, ethical, and operational support to clinicians is available during and after business hours, especially where patient care guidance is required.
  • Ensures that all pharmacy and clinical operations, practices, and procedures meet all licensing and standard requirements established by state, federal, and regulatory agencies.
  • Oversees coordination and development of REMS program management tools to comply with FDA medication requirements and company process.   
  • Ensures coordination related to Clinical Services support across company departments which may include reimbursement, sales and marketing, operations, procurement, human resources and compliance teams.
  • Develops and monitors Location Performance Improvement Programs, including location audits, in accordance with Company policies and procedures.
  • Serves as a drug information resource to the company.
  • Contributes to professional body of knowledge and advancing the company within the industry through preparing papers, reports, posters, presenting, for Company management and professional publications and conferences.
  • Directs Clinical Services development of resources for new drugs, indications, and formulation to support implementation and team member clinical competency with. 
  • Maintains clinical skills and knowledge of pharmacotherapy, intravenous therapy, sterile compounding through ongoing education, reviewing literature, and participation in relevant in-services, seminars, and conferences. 
  • Conduct branch audits and record audits regularly to identify areas for improvement and ensure compliance with quality standards.
  • Communicates effectively and follows established channels of authority and communications throughout the organization.
  • Adheres to all Company Policies, Procedures, and Standards of Conduct covered during initial orientation and referenced in branch handbooks, guides, and manuals.
  • Reports to the appropriate manager(s) any known or suspected of violations of policies and procedures, regulations, or standards of conduct.
